Can you cook frozen steak?

Yes, you can cook frozen steak. Actually, it was found that frozen steak doesn’t have the dreaded gray band and also it retains more moisture during cooking. How can you cook frozen steak?

To cook a frozen steak, just get the following ingredients and apply the following instructions:-

Ingredients needed in order  to cook steak from frozen

  • 4 frozen steaks of about 1 to 1 and a half inches thick ( porterhouse, ribeye or t-bone).
  • 3 tablespoons of olive oil.
  • Salt and pepper.

Instructions to follow in order to cook a steak from frozen

  1. Preheat your oven to around 275 degrees fahrenheit.
  2. Place a wire rack in a rimmed baking sheet and set aside.
  3. Heat olive oil to a smoking point in a large skillet.
  4. Remove skillet from heat.
  5. Add the steak onto the skillet and wait a moment.
  6. Add the skillet back to the heat, sear 90 seconds on each side until the formation of a brown crust.
  7. Transfer the steaks into the wire rack.
  8. Add salt and pepper.
  9. Bake the steaks for about 18 to 30 minutes.
  10. Allow to rest for around 5 minutes.
  11. Serve and enjoy these amazing steaks.

Can you reheat your cooked steak leftovers?

Yes, you can reheat your cooked steak leftovers. In order to reheat them, just apply the following simple inst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to around 250 degrees fahrenheit.
  2. Place the steaks on a wire rack over a baking tray.
  3. To lock in the moisture, cover the steaks with aluminum foil.
  4. Cook the steaks for around 20 to 30 minutes.
  5. Allow the steaks to rest for a while.
  6. Meanwhile, melt some butter in a skillet over high heat.
  7. Sear the steak leftovers for about 30 seconds on each side in order to get the crisp crust back.

Can you store your cooked steak in the fridge?

Yes, you can surely store your cooked steak in the refrigerator. This can be easily done through properly packing the steaks in airtight containers and storing them in the refrigerator at temperatures lower than 40 degrees fahrenheit in order to prevent any sort of bacterial growth. These steaks can last in the refrigerator for about 3 to 4 days.

Can you store cooked steak in the freezer?

Yes, you can simply store your cooked steak in the freezer. This can be easily done through properly packing the steaks in airtight containers and storing them in the freezer. These steaks can last in the freezer for up to three months without any degradation in the meat’s quality.

How to know that the steak is bad or spoiled?

  • If the steak has discolored.
  • If the steak has any slimy appearance.
  • If the steak has a slimy texture on its surface.
  • If the steak has a sticky texture.
  • If the steak has a rancid smell.
  • If you are unsure if your steak is safe to eat, just try to be on the safe side and throw it away to avoid getting sick.
